Migrations on the Copperline service follow the expand-contract pattern: add the new column or table first, deploy code that writes to both, backfill via the Threshbot job, then drop the old structure in a later release. Never combine expand and contract in one deploy. The migration runner refuses destructive changes during peak hours by design. If a migration stalls mid-backfill or locks a hot table, pause it and escalate — don't force it. For anything ambiguous, ask the schema stewards before proceeding.

escalation mailbox, bafog-fafog: ulador@paliqlabs.internal

MEMO — BRANCH MANAGERS

The Corvane reseller programme launches next month. Tiered margins replace flat discounts; onboarding packs ship to all branches this week. Direct questions to your regional lead. Do not announce terms to partners until head office confirms. Keep timelines internal. The rationale behind this rollout is set out in the confidential note below.

board note of bawep-tajef: Queniusek Systems plans to raise the Quenvan list price by 53.1 percent in March. The pricing group signed off on a budget of $176.4 million for Project Drueth. The renewal with Casionix Partners closes at $142.5 million a year, 8.3 percent below the last contract. Project Fraax slips by six weeks because of the tooling delay.

/* Consent banner rollout for the Dovetrail web surface. These constants control staged exposure: the banner starts at a small percentage of sessions and ramps automatically if dismissal-error rates stay below threshold. Consent state is recorded before any non-essential script loads, and the rollout halts on validation failures. Reviewers should confirm the ramp schedule matches the approved privacy plan. The current stage gates are defined below. */

tuning table, yajog-yahof:
BUDGETS = {
    "lamvan": 303,
    "wenox": 460,
    "fenvan": 525,
}

Subject: Incremental rebuilds land in Quillstone 5.1

Plugin authors: Quillstone now rebuilds only pages whose content hash or template dependency changed. Your plugins must declare all file inputs via the new manifest hook, or affected pages may be skipped during incremental passes. Full rebuilds remain available with the --clean flag. Please verify against the staging artifact; its trace token is listed below.

trace token, fafog-kageg: htk4_98e6